Check out elephriends Peter Mortimer and Nick Rosen’s nytimes.com video story on Dean Potter (who sat down with his wife, Steph, and Waylon on elevision last month). Watch Dean parachute off of cliffs, climb rock faces with no safety rope, and baseline (like tightrope walking, minus the net and circus tent) across a canyon in Utah. He says that the adrenalin rush brings him back to the present moment (after all, if he’s not paying attention he could die in a second)…but I was quite happy to watch from the comfort of my couch.
